WebThe current thinking is that psoriasis affects between 2% and 3% of the UK population - up to 1.8 million people - although this is an estimate. It affects males and females equally. Psoriasis can occur at any age, although there seem to be two ‘peaks’; from the late teens to early thirties, and between the ages of around 50 and 60. WebSep 2, 2024 · Tattoos and MRIs. WebOct 24, 2012 · Introduction. Psoriasis is an inflammatory skin disease that typically follows a relapsing and remitting course. The prevalence of psoriasis is estimated to be around 1.3% to 2.2% in the UK. Psoriasis can occur at any age, although is uncommon in children (0.71%) and most cases occur before 35 years. Interestingly, the period between a skin injury and the presentation of psoriasis can range from three days to two years, according to a 2011 study in Clinical Dermatology. There are even cases where tattoos completed decades earlier will suddenly be the primary (and sometimes initial) site of a psoriatic flare.

WebFeb 18, 2024 · Psoriasis can be caused or triggered by a skin injury or skin lesions. Skin trauma such as sunburns or cuts can also be a culprit. A new tattoo may even lead to a first-time psoriasis reaction in people who may be at risk for developing the condition, even if it is not their first tattoo.
